GPT-6 Astra claimed as new SOTA in agentic CAD by early users, unverified
Scobleizer · x · 2026-09-05
Users are hyping GPT-6 Astra, with one calling it "a compiler for atoms" and another claiming it sets a new SOTA in agentic CAD and marks a step change in AI-driven mechanical design. These are third-party impressions; OpenAI has not confirmed any GPT-6 release or benchmark results.
